WebApr 7, 2024 · The given equation to be balanced is C4H 10 +O2 → CO2 +H 2O We begin by counting the number of C atoms on both sides. We have 4C on the left and 1C on the right. ⇒ C4H 10 + O2 → 4CO2 +H 2O wwwwwwwwwwww Now count the number of H atoms on both sides. WebApr 1, 2024 · Hint: This reaction is the combustion of butane because the butane is reacted with oxygen to form carbon dioxide and water. To balance the equation, first balance the carbon atoms and then balance the hydrogen and oxygen atoms.
